
Souheil Badran is executive vice president and chief operating officer at Northwestern Mutual. He is accountable for the insurance and investment operations of the company, which comprise New Business, Risk and Investment Client Services, and Policy Benefits. His organization is also responsible for the company's center of excellence around enterprise operational efficiency and performance.
Badran joined NM in 2019 and was responsible for identifying opportunities in innovation communities and overseeing Northwestern Mutual Future Ventures, Cream City Venture Capital, and the Wisconn Valley Venture Fund.
Before joining Northwestern Mutual, Badran served as president of Alipay Americas, the world’s largest third-party payment platform, where he was responsible for enhancing the buying experience of millions of Chinese consumers by bringing mobile and online payments to merchants in North and South America. Prior to Alipay, Badran served as president and chief executive officer of Edo Interactive, senior vice president and general manager of Digital River, and senior vice president and general manager for First Data Corporation’s Ecommerce Solutions Group. He began his career in Milwaukee at M&I Data Services.
Throughout his career, Badran has had experience with organizations that ranged from venture capital-funded, private equity-owned to various public companies. His career has led him to gain global experience across the ecommerce, big data, security, and payment industries.
Badran, born in Lebanon, graduated from Cardinal Stritch University with a bachelor’s degree in computer science and a master’s degree in business administration. He serves on the Research Board of Children’s Hospital of Wisconsin.
